随机数生成算法 方法: 线性同余法 乘法逆法 梅森旋转法 示例程序(Python): import random # 使用线性同余法生成随机数 random.seed(42) # 设置随机数种子 print(random.randint(1, 10)) # 生成 1 到 10 之间的随机整数 C++ 25 次浏览 2024-06-09
iOS随机数生成方法示例 在iOS开发中,有时我们需要实现一个功能,即在特定范围内随机选取一个值,这在游戏、抽奖应用或者任何需要随机性的场景中都很常见。以下是如何在指定的数值范围内生成随机数的示例: // 初始化随机数种子,确保每次运行时随机性 srand(time(NULL)); // 生成1到10之间的随机数 int r IOS 20 次浏览 2024-10-31
如何生成安全的随机数 为了生成一个安全的随机数,您可以使用加密算法来确保随机性和安全性。同时,您可以启动一个计时器,在每20秒的间隔内刷新随机数,以增加安全性。这样做可以防止攻击者预测随机数的生成模式。 IOS 21 次浏览 2024-05-25
JavaScript随机数生成方法研究 深入探讨了JavaScript中多种生成随机数的方案。文章首先介绍了使用内置函数Math.random()生成0到1之间随机数的基本方法,并以此为基础,详细阐述了如何生成指定范围内的随机整数和浮点数。此外,文章还探索了利用Date对象以及Crypto API生成更安全的随机数的方法,并对每种方法的适 Nodejs 22 次浏览 2024-06-13